Anyone tweek with the internal volume adjustment on theirs? Seems like i have a *slight* volume drop at the 12 oçlock balance position, but not so much at other extremes. how sensitive is that little sucka?
Re: Infanem: Compact Faye Sing
Posted: Tue Apr 03, 2012 10:29 am
by coldbrightsunlight
I had what you described, so I turned the trimpot up a bit, and now I have unity volume around 10-2 oclock balance and a very slight boost at either extreme. Works a lot better for me.
